    Oh, your 10,000ATK BESD rickyp2004 is cool, but highly unfeasible. Firstly, not many people would actually fuse three BEWDs into Blue Eyes Ultimate, I think BEUD players will wait for Cyber-stein to come out and use it's effect (pay 5000LP to special a fusion monster from your fusion deck). Secondly, Megamorph's effect only works if your LP is lower than your opponent's. I'd rather stick to the good old BEUD one-hit-kill:

    1x mass monster removal card (ie Torrential Tribute)
    1x Cyber-stein
    1x Blue Eyes Ultimate Dragon
    1x Megamorph.

    First, clear the field Summon Cyber-stein, blow 5000LP to special summon BEUD, equip it with megamorph. If you do this early in the game (even your second turn), chances are your LP will be lower than your opponent's after the 5000 loss. Megamorph increases BEUD's attack to 9000, and since the field is empty, attack directly and win. Just pray they don't have magic cylinders, or something.
